Brass Alloys: Exploring Strength and Beauty

Brass alloys stand out for their unique blend of strength and beauty. These metallic mixtures, primarily composed of copper and zinc, offer a wide range of properties that make them ideal for diverse applications. The proportions of copper and zinc can be carefully adjusted to achieve specific characteristics, yielding alloys with varying levels of hardness, durability, and color. From the antique charm of heritage brass to the modern appeal of innovative brass finishes, these alloys captivate the eye while providing reliable performance.

  • Brass alloys are acknowledged for their resistance to corrosion and wear, making them suitable for outdoor applications and demanding environments.

Brass Polishing: Achieving a Long-Lasting Sheen

Unlocking a lustrous brass shine is easier more easily you think! With suitable care and correct tools, your brass decorations can radiate a brilliant finish for years to come. Start by acquiring essential supplies like cotton rags, metal cleaner, and elbow grease. Clean your brass thoroughly with warm, soapy water before using the polish in even motions. Wipe away any excess polish with a clean cloth and let it to air dry completely. For extra shine, buff the brass with a soft cloth.

Often cleaning and polishing your brass will prevent tarnish and maintain its vibrant finish. Tuck away your polished brass in a dry place, protected against moisture and humidity. With a little effort, you can enjoy the radiant brilliance of your brass for generations to come.
